Full Description of Event/Sighting: Me and my mother were in our backyard when I spotted a very bright Venus like light moving in an east/west direction, (towards Dartmoor.) The sky was clear and there were no other stars visible at that time. It was flying relatively low in comparison to a plane and it wasn't hanging around either.

Neither me or her have a clue as to what it might possibly be. Whatever it was I have never seen anything shine so brightly in the daylight sky as this. When I ran indoors to grab my binoculars the object was almost out of focus.
